| From: | Laurenz Albe <laurenz(dot)albe(at)cybertec(dot)at> |
|---|---|
| To: | Rajan Pandey <rajanpandey2508(at)gmail(dot)com>, pgsql-general(at)lists(dot)postgresql(dot)org |
| Subject: | Re: Postgres_FDW doc doesn't specify TYPE support in Remote Execution Options |
| Date: | 2024-04-09 10:36:08 |
| Message-ID: | 54d1adf4bca421ef355fd26c259ba83016cc09a9.camel@cybertec.at |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-docs pgsql-general |
On Tue, 2024-04-09 at 15:49 +0530, Rajan Pandey wrote:
> I was reading https://www.postgresql.org/docs/current/postgres-fdw.html#POSTGRES-FDW-OPTIONS-REMOTE-EXECUTION
> and found that it mentions that Immutable Functions and Operators can
> be pushed down using `extensions` option for foreign server.
>
> But it does not mention about TYPE. In the shippable.c/lookup_shippable()
> function, I found that type is also pushed down.
The comment only says that data types may be shippable, but not that
they are actually shipped. Can you think of a case where a data type
would be shipped to a foreign server? I wrote a foreign data wrapper,
and I cannot think of such a case.
Perhaps the function comment should be adjusted by removing the parenthesis
or changing it to "(operator/function/...)".
> Does this require updating the docs? Can I raise a PR to do so? Thank you! :)
You would send a patch against the "master" branch to the pgsql-docs list for that.
Yours,
Laurenz Albe
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Laurenz Albe | 2024-04-09 11:16:51 | Re: 8.14.5 jsonb subscripting |
| Previous Message | Rajan Pandey | 2024-04-09 10:19:39 | Postgres_FDW doc doesn't specify TYPE support in Remote Execution Options |
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Laurenz Albe | 2024-04-09 10:38:09 | Re: Regarding: Replication of TRUNCATE commands is not working |
| Previous Message | Rajan Pandey | 2024-04-09 10:19:39 | Postgres_FDW doc doesn't specify TYPE support in Remote Execution Options |